I can’t hate this car more

Kelly smith , 07/21/2021
2022 Honda Odyssey EX-L 4dr Minivan (3.5L 6cyl 10A)
74 of 86 people found this review helpful

Been a longtime Toyota person but tried a Honda. Needed a van for the kids. I’ve had this car less than a week and I have major regrets about the purchase. First, the electronics. They are glitchy beyond belief. Half the time Apple car play doesn’t work. 2/3 of the time the climate controls don’t work. This van is also very far from quiet. I guess it’s all relative but my old Toyota was quieter. I also got warning lights about total loss of steering while going 70mph on a highway. Nice. Thankfully it was fast, but when the electronics in the car don’t work, that includes steering. Last but not least, I absolutely HATE the design of the driver seat. It’s literally back-breaking. Didn’t realize I’d need weekly chiropractor adjustments just to be able to have a van. I don’t think they could have made that seat more uncomfortable if they tried. Little things: I like the glasses compartments but there are not enough cubbies for other things. The driver armrest also blocks the seatbelt buckle. The third row latch doesn’t work half the time on one side. I hate this car and I’ll be that person who trades in within a year (and that’s if I make it even that far) at a huge loss. Never again. Just no. Absolutely horrible.

So far so good.

James, 09/18/2021
2022 Honda Odyssey EX-L 4dr Minivan (3.5L 6cyl 10A)
24 of 27 people found this review helpful

Wow, reading some of these reviews is scary. I thought they fixed transmission issues when they upgraded from the 9 speed to the 10 speed, but I guess not? That's a bummer. Our van has been great so far, but we've only had it 1 month. I'll update later if anything changes. We own a 2009 Odyssey as well, and the 2022 seats sit MUCH lower. Switching between the 2 vans, the 2022 feels like a car seat while the 09 sits high up like a truck. Very strange. The armrests are a downgrade, especially the pencil thin rests in the 2nd row. They're a joke. The driver-side rest is shorter than the 2009 so half my arm is hanging off it. I love the technology. For the one struggling with carplay issues, just make sure to use a better Apple cable. No problems after switching from a generic one. Love the ACC and LKAS. The van can pretty much drive itself on the interstate. I hope we can get 12 years out of this van like our old one. Oh, the A/C is not as cold as the 2009. I blame the switch to R1234yf for that. Thanks to the environmentalists.... :-/

Overall poor choice, basic features don’t work

Craig, 08/03/2023
updated 08/05/2025
2022 Honda Odyssey Touring 4dr Minivan (3.5L 6cyl 10A)
8 of 8 people found this review helpful

Overall, I am sorry that I purchased this vehicle - it is just not up to the standards of previous models. The touchscreen has never worked properly. It is a major distraction to use as it takes at least 2-3 taps to get anything working and multiple functions just do not work at all because the tapping does not do anything. Incredible distraction while driving and not really possible to change radio stations or heat and stay within marked lanes. CarPlay is also problematic and it typically takes 3-4 tried to get it to recognize any phone even though the phone is getting power. Again - trying to get it working is an incredible distraction while driving and it never connects properly to the car if not running. The idle stop does not work and the dealer had no idea how to fix it. Basically it’s a piece of crap and I am strongly considering counting my losses and getting rid of it. One other issue is that the rear hatch does not open enough so at 6 feet tall I hit my head putting things in the back. Such a disappointment.

Great Family Car

Marlon Bachini, 01/02/2022
2022 Honda Odyssey Touring 4dr Minivan (3.5L 6cyl 10A)
15 of 17 people found this review helpful

Saw the reviews about the transmission and owned the van six months with 8K. So far, the vehicle has been great, took a trip to Florida and great family car. My only qualms is the tech is a bit old and the wifi hotspot is really slow. Wished they had some streaming capability since most kids watch Netflix or YouTube. Terms of driving, you can tell the difference between a V6 and 4 cylinder, instant torque you need in the Highway. This is my 4th Honda and been loyal to the brand since I never had no major issues. Just did the regular maintenance schedule.

Likes Gas

Honda Odyssey EXL, 06/19/2023
updated 06/23/2025
2022 Honda Odyssey EX-L 4dr Minivan (3.5L 6cyl 10A)
9 of 10 people found this review helpful

The Honda Odyssey EXL has got a pretty classy interior. The engine and transmission combination is fairly smooth, but I've driven better (and I've driven worse). My biggest complaint is I'm not getting anywhere near the mileage rating which is advertised for that vehicle. The ride is also a bit overly smooth reminicent of a '79 Caddy. Could be just a bit tighter for my taste.I've test driven all the other new minivans and the Honda was as at least as good, if not better than the others. The new hybrid Sienna had a loud engine and did not feel as solid as the Honda. The Kia Carnival was on par with the Honda. So was the Pacifica.
